Chicago's independent music scene continues to produce artists who refuse to limit themselves to a single lane, and MoniQue is a perfect example.
During her recent interview with Chiraq Magazine, MoniQue discussed her latest single, "Da One," her role in the stage production "The Return of Motown," and the creative journey that's continuing to shape her career.
For many artists, music and acting are viewed as two separate worlds. For MoniQue, they're simply two different ways to connect with an audience.
Her latest release, "Da One," showcases her R&B style while adding another chapter to her growing catalog. At the same time, her involvement in "The Return of Motown" demonstrates her ability to step beyond the recording studio and bring that same creative energy to the stage.
Throughout the interview, the conversation moved beyond current projects and focused on the importance of growth, consistency, and artistic evolution. Balancing music, live performances, and acting requires versatility, but MoniQue continues to embrace every opportunity to expand her craft.
As independent artists continue to redefine success, creators like MoniQue remind audiences that talent isn't always confined to a single platform. Whether through music, theater, or future creative projects, her focus remains the same: continue creating, continue performing, and continue building.
